Hydraulic fracturing or "fracking" is a drilling method that pushes water and chemicals into wells to force out oil and gas deposits. Fracking has led to cheaper prices for natural gas and less dependence on foreign sources for energy, but many people have concerns about its environmental impact…from the chemicals and amount of water used in the process, to its impact on ground water and the disposal of fracking waste.
